The Ultimate Guide to Types of Bed Decor: Style Your Sleep Sanctuary

Selecting the right bed decor is one of the most effective ways to transform the ambiance of a bedroom, turning a simple sleeping space into a personal sanctuary. The textiles, colors, and arrangements you choose directly influence the room’s comfort level, aesthetic appeal, and overall atmosphere, making it essential to understand the various categories available. Rather than viewing bed decor as a single item, it is more helpful to break it down into functional and stylistic groups that work together to create a cohesive look. From the foundational layers that provide utility to the surface decorations that add personality, each element plays a distinct role in the design.

The Foundational Layers: Comfort and Utility

Before exploring visual elements, it is important to address the structural layers that define the bed’s form and function. These components are the skeleton of the bedding, providing support and comfort while lying beneath the decorative finishes. Investing in high-quality foundational pieces ensures the bed remains comfortable throughout the seasons and provides a smooth canvas for the more artistic decor elements.

Mattress Toppers and Protectors

While often hidden from view, mattress toppers and protectors are critical components of bed decor that influence the sleeping experience significantly. A high-density foam or memory foam topper can add a plush, cushiony feel to a firm mattress, while a latex topper offers responsive support and temperature neutrality. These layers also serve a protective function, shielding the primary mattress from dust, stains, and general wear, which extends the life of the furniture and maintains its hygienic integrity.

Mattress Encasements and Foundations

Mattress encasements act as a barrier against allergens, bed bugs, and moisture, providing a defensive layer that protects the investment in your sleep surface. Box springs and foundations, on the other hand, are responsible for the height and rigidity of the bed; they create the necessary lift for ease of getting in and out of bed and work in tandem with the mattress to provide the correct level of back support. The choice between a traditional box spring, a solid foundation, or a platform bed base will dictate the overall height and structural feel of the bedroom.

The Surface Aesthetics: Texture and Color

The most visible aspects of bed decor are the textiles that cover the mattress, which establish the room’s color palette, pattern scale, and tactile quality. These layers work in harmony to create visual depth, and understanding how to mix them is key to achieving a balanced and sophisticated look. The goal is to balance practicality with beauty, ensuring the materials can withstand daily use while contributing to the design narrative.

Sheets and Pillowcases: The Base Palette

Sheets are the largest visible surface area on the bed, making them the anchor of the color scheme. High-thread-count cotton or breathable linen materials offer a luxurious sheen and smooth drape that elevate the room’s perceived quality. When selecting sheets, consider the finish: percale provides a crisp, cool feel with a matte look, while sateen offers a subtle sheen and a softer handfeel. These base layers set the stage for all other decorative elements, so choosing versatile, neutral tones allows for easy seasonal updates.

Comforters, Duvets, and Quilts

Layerings are central to bed styling, serving both practical and decorative purposes. A duvet insert provides insulation and warmth and is often protected by a decorative cover, while a comforter offers a quilted, all-in-one solution that requires less layering. For visual impact, many designers opt to use a quilt as the top layer, folding back the foot of the bed to reveal the intricate stitching and create a “hospital corners” effect. This technique adds structure and a tailored appearance that instantly polishes the room.

The Accent Elements: Dimension and Personality

Once the foundational and base layers are established, the accents are what allow a bedroom to express individual personality. These items are typically easier to swap out seasonally or as trends change, allowing homeowners to refresh the look of the room without investing in new large textiles. The strategic placement of these accents adds dimension, turning a flat sleeping surface into a curated display.

Blankets, Throws, and Pillows

Blankets and throws are the easiest way to introduce texture and a pop of color. Drape a chunky knit throw over the foot of the bed or a velvet blanket across the white linens to create contrast and visual interest. Pillows are the primary tools for adding volume and sophistication; combining standard sleeping pillows with Euro shams and decorative bolster pillows creates a layered, luxurious effect. Varying the sizes and textures—from smooth satin to nubby boucle—adds depth and makes the bed feel inviting rather than staged.

Bed Skirts and Canopies

Bed skirts soften the transition between the sleeping surface and the floor, concealing storage space and box springs for a cleaner, more finished look. They are particularly effective in traditional or cottage-style bedrooms, adding a touch of formality. Conversely, bed canopies introduce a sense of drama and romance, creating a focal point that frames the bed like a piece of art. Whether opting for a minimal four-poster frame or a flowing fabric drape, these elements transform the bed into a true centerpiece of the room.

Harmonizing the Space

To ensure the bed decor feels intentional rather than chaotic, it is important to consider how these elements interact with the surrounding room. The bed should complement the wall color, flooring, and existing furniture rather than competing with them. Adhering to a cohesive design principle—whether that is matching undertones, sticking to a limited color palette, or mixing specific textures—brings a sense of order to the space. By treating the bed as a complete ensemble rather than a collection of separate items, one can achieve a look that is both stylish and livable.
